Electroculture is a fascinating science that explores the effects of electricity on plant growth. Proponents believe that carefully administered electrical currents can enhance a variety of elements in the growing cycle, leading to robust plants and increased yields. Some practitioners experiment techniques like grounding, Tesla coils, and even direct shocks to influence plant development. While the science of electroculture is still being debated within the scientific community, many growers report to its positive effects.
- Possible advantages include accelerated development, greater bioavailability, and increased resistance to pests and diseases
- Limitations in electroculture research include establishing clear pathways of action, standardizing methods, and conducting rigorous empirical investigations
As our understanding of plant physiology continues to evolve, electroculture may emerge as a valuable method for sustainable agriculture, offering a alternative approach to growing healthy and productive crops.

Harnessing Electrical Energy for Thriving Plants: An Introduction to Electroculture Gardening
Electroculture gardening is a fascinating method of cultivating plants by utilizing electrical energy. This innovative technique involves the application of low-voltage direct current to the soil and growing media, aiming to enhance their growth and yield.
The fundamental principle behind electroculture is that electricity can enhance various physiological processes within plants, such as nutrient uptake, photosynthesis, and overall development. While the exact mechanisms are still being researched, proponents of electroculture believe that it can lead to vigorous plants with increased resistance from pests and diseases.
Electroculture methods differ from simple setups involving wire coils to more sophisticated systems that utilize specialized devices.
